In the 9th century, Pope Leo IV reinforced the fortifications around the Vatican Hill after the Basilicas of St Peters and St Pauls Outside the Walls were sacked byAghlabids Islamicraiders from Northern Africa in 845. From the 3rd to the 17th century, the Aurelian Walls protected the city. The credit for the Porta San Giovanniusually goes to Giacomo della Porta, although some argue it was actually Giacomo del Duca, an architect who collaborated with Michelangelo on the Porta Pia in 1561. Youll be looking at the most complete run of the 6th century BC Servian Wall of Rome.When it was completed, the 33 tall, 12 thick Servian Wall ran for 7 miles around the ancient city.
